Steps

Read instructions and get ready to cook

1
Prepare oven

Preheat the oven to 325°F (165°C).

2
Make crust

Crush graham crackers into fine crumbs. Mix with melted butter and 1/4 cup sugar.

3
Form crust

Press the mixture into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an.

4
Bake crust

Bake the crust for 10 minutes, then remove from oven and let cool.

5
Prepare filling

In a large bowl, beat cream cheese until smooth.

6
Add sugar

Gradually add the remaining sugar to the cream cheese, beating until combined.

7
Add eggs

Beat in eggs one at a time, mixing on low speed.

8
Add remaining ingredients

Stir in heavy cream, sour cream, vanilla extract, salt, and flour until just combined.

9
Pour filling

Pour the filling over the cooled crust in the springform pan.

10
Prepare water bath

Wrap the outside of the pan in aluminum foil. Place in a larger baking pan and add hot water to come halfway up the sides of the springform pan.

11
Bake cheesecake

Bake for 1 hour and 30 minutes, or until center is almost set.

12
Cool in oven

Turn off the oven and leave the cheesecake inside with the door closed for 1 hour.

13
Refrigerate

Remove from oven, run a knife around the edge, and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.

14
Serve

Remove from springform pan, slice, and serve chilled.
